Brewery Visits

(H)Alt! 4 Beers! Brewery! Tour! - Brewery Visits

A rotating selection of Düsseldorf’s most renowned breweries await visitors on this immersive tour.

The tour may include stops at fan-favorite breweries like Füchsen, known for its clever marketing, and Retematäng Bar, which boasts a humorous backstory.

Newer additions to the city’s brewing scene, such as Olbermann, offer a chance to sample innovative takes on the classic Altbier.

The tour also features historic institutions like Schlüssel, owned by the same family since 1313, and Uerige, notable for its iconic weather vane.

Altbier Vs. Kölsch

(H)Alt! 4 Beers! Brewery! Tour! - Altbier Vs. Kölsch

Altbier and Kölsch are two distinct beer styles that have long defined the brewing traditions of Düsseldorf and Cologne, respectively.

While both are top-fermented ales, they differ in several key ways:

  • Altbier is typically darker, with a malty, slightly bitter taste, while Kölsch is a light, golden, and more delicate beer.

  • Altbier is conditioned for a longer period, giving it a fuller body and drier finish.

  • Kölsch is fermented at cooler temperatures, resulting in a crisp, refreshing character.

  • Altbier production is centered in Düsseldorf, while Kölsch is the signature beer of Cologne.

  • Proper etiquette dictates that Altbier is served in a curved glass, while Kölsch is enjoyed in a tall, narrow Stange.
